Transaction 268b8d72ebc96bfbd4bc97aef3fbb88b7101a61e3e2d2b93f3a465a77f96f577

24 Input
2 Outputs
  • 268b8d72ebc96bfbd4bc97aef3fbb88b7101a61e3e2d2b93f3a465a77f96f577:0
  • value  2087660100
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 268b8d72ebc96bfbd4bc97aef3fbb88b7101a61e3e2d2b93f3a465a77f96f577:1
  • value  1339178
    address  1EwH91AZSzSLa7qjPSgNpQUQv4gdo5J5tM